Thaddeus Andrew Koresko – Celebration Of Life 5/7/23

Thaddeus Andrew Koresko (Thad), 44 of Ohio, formerly of Aledo, Illinois, left his earthly body for his Heavenly body on Wednesday, April 19, 2023. A memorial service was held on Wednesday, April 26, at Sheridan Funeral Home, Lancaster, Ohio. All friends and family are invited to a Celebration of Life gathering in Thad’s memory to be held from 2 to 4 p.m., Sunday, May 7, at Messiah Lutheran Church in Aledo. This is a small way to say thank you for all the prayers, love, and support. Memorial contributions may be made to Thad’s children, c/o Lindsay Koresko.

Thad was born on November 27, 1978, to Andrew A. and Carol S. (Bloomfield) Koresko in Aledo. Thad graduated from Aledo High School with perfect attendance in May 1997. He graduated from Hamilton Tech Engineering with a bachelor’s degree in 2000.

He met the love of his life on an internet Star Wars gaming chat room; and he transferred to Ohio to be near her. On July 18, 2004, Thad and Lindsay E. Brown were united in marriage. Thad was baptized into the family of God on May 6, 1979, and reaffirmed his baptism with Lindsay’s baptism during their wedding ceremony.

Thad was a loving and devoted husband and Daddy. At the time of his death, he was employed by Highlights for Children magazine in Columbus, Ohio, as a computer tech. Besides his family, Thad loved his dogs. As a child of the ’80s, he also had a passion for Star Wars, Transformers, and, later on, Corvettes.

Thad is survived by his wife of nearly 19 years, Lindsay; sons, James, Lucas, and Bryce; his parents; brother, Kyle Koresko and sister, Amanda (Josh) Dail; two nieces and one nephew; his other parents, Jonathan and Debra Brown; brother-in-law, Nathan (Christina) Brown; and numerous aunts, uncles, and cousins.
